Страница 1 из 1

Как сбросить настройки протокола TCP/IP

СообщениеДобавлено: 12 апр 2010 13:07, Пн
UncleFather
Выполняем все рекомендации:

  • Чистим временные папки
    • %Temp%
    • %WinDir%\Temp
    • Временные папки для всех пользователей: C:\Documents And Settings\UserName\LocalSettings\Temp
    • Временные папки Internet Explorer для всех пользователей: C:\Documents And Settings\UserName\LocalSettings\Temporary Internet Files
      !!!Важно!!! НЕ ЗАБЫВАЕМ ЧИСТИТЬ ПОЛЬЗОВАТЕЛЯ «NetworkService»
    • До кучи выполняем еще полную очистку Internet Explorer - удаляем всё, включая данные и файлы созданные дополнениями (аддонами)
      Код: Выделить всё
      RunDll32.exe InetCpl.cpl,ClearMyTracksByProcess 4351
    • При необходимости удаляем с дисков папки «RECYCLER», «RECYCLED» и содержимое папки «SYSTEM VOLUME INFORMATION»

  • Сбрасываем настройки протокола TCP/IP:
    Код: Выделить всё
    netsh int ip reset Resetlog.txt
    netsh winsock reset

    При выполнении команды reset, она перезаписывает два ключа в реестре, которые используются TCP/IP. Это то же самое, что удалить и вновь установить протокол. Команда reset перезаписывает следующие два ключа в реестре:
    • SYSTEM\CurrentControlSet\Services\Tcpip\Parameters\
    • SYSTEM\CurrentControlSet\Services\DHCP\Parameters\

  • Сброс параметров протокола Интернета (TCP/IP). Утилиту качаем здесь

  • Проверка целостности конфигурации Winsock2 и ее восстановление. Утилиту качаем здесь


Переустановка протокола TCP/IP:

  • Удаляем разделы реестра:
    Код: Выделить всё
    Windows Registry Editor Version 5.00

    [-HKEY_LOCAL_MACHINE\System\CurrentControlSet\Services\Winsock]
    [-HKEY_LOCAL_MACHINE\System\CurrentControlSet\Services\Winsock2]


  • Перезагружаем компьютер. После перезагрузки Windows XP создаст эти разделы заново. Если после удаления указанных разделов реестра не перезагрузить компьютер, то следующий этап будет выполнен с ошибками.

  • Установка TCP/IP:

    1. Подключение по локальной сети - Свойства - Установить - Протокол - Добавить - Установить с диска - C:\Windows\inf

    2. В списке протоколов выбираем Протокол Интернета (TCP/IP) (Если пункт Протокол Интернета (TCP/IP) недоступен, находим поиском файл nettcpip.inf щелкаем его правой кнопкой мыши - Установить.

    3. Перезапускаем компьютер.


Если уже совсем ничего не помогает:

  1. Удаляем сетевую карту вместе с драйверами (из Диспетчера устройств)

  2. Копируем содержимое архива (драйвера некоторых умолчательных сетевых устройств, клиентов и протоколов) в папку %systemroot%\System32\Drivers
    drivers.rar
    (430.51 КБ) Скачиваний: 338


  3. Делаем резервную копию ветки реестра H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Network, потом удаляем ее и импортируем ее же, но с рабочего компьютера сходной конфигурации*.
    Код: Выделить всё
    reg delete H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Network /f


  4. Делаем резервную копию ветки реестра H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Dhcp, потом удаляем ее и импортируем ее же, но с рабочего компьютера сходной конфигурации*.
    Код: Выделить всё
    reg delete H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Dhcp /f


  5. Делаем резервную копию ветки реестра H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SharedAccess, потом удаляем ее и импортируем ее же, но с рабочего компьютера сходной конфигурации*.
    Код: Выделить всё
    reg delete H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SharedAccess /f


  6. Делаем резервную копию ветки реестра H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ip, потом удаляем ее и импортируем ее же, но с рабочего компьютера сходной конфигурации*.
    Код: Выделить всё
    reg delete H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ip /f


  7. Делаем резервную копию ветки реестра H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\WinSock, потом удаляем ее и импортируем ее же, но с рабочего компьютера сходной конфигурации*.
    Код: Выделить всё
    reg delete H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\WinSock /f


  8. Делаем резервную копию ветки реестра H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\WinSock2, потом удаляем ее и импортируем ее же, но с рабочего компьютера сходной конфигурации*.
    Код: Выделить всё
    reg delete H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\WinSock2 /f


  9. Перезагружаемся

  10. Устанавливаем драйвера для сетевой карты

  11. Выполняем команды:
    Код: Выделить всё
    netsh int ip reset Resetlog.txt
    netsh winsock reset


  12. Перезагружаемся

  13. Из-за того, что мы импортировали параметры реестра с другого компьютера, необходимо вернуть свои старые настроики, для чего:

    • Меняем имя компьютера (Если он был членом домена, то выводим его из домена и вводим заново)

    • Настраиваем параметры сетевых служб и протоколов (в частности, протокола TCP/IP)

    • Настраиваем правила брандмауэра

  14. Перезагружаемся


* Под сходной конфигурацией имеется ввиду то, что должны соответствовать установленные сетевые протоколы, службы и клиенты (например, если на проблемном компьютере стоял Kaspersky Antivirus NDIS Filter, то на компьютере, которого реестр импортируем, он тоже должен стоять). Так же желательно импортировать реестр с компьютера со сходной конфигурацией железа.


Сброс настроек протокола Интернета TCP/IP для Windows 7 и Windows 2008 Server:

  1. Запускаем командную строку с правами Администратора

  2. Последовательно выполняем команды сброса:


  3. Выполняем команду отключения автотюнинга:
    Код: Выделить всё
    netsh interface tcp set global autotuninglevel=disabled


  4. Перезагружаемся

Примечание:

Можно создать командный файл следующего содержания:
Код: Выделить всё
ipconfig /flushdns
nbtstat -R
nbtstat -RR
netsh int reset all
netsh int ip reset
netsh winsock reset
netsh interface tcp set global autotuninglevel=disabled


и просто запустить его от имени Администратора, а затем перезагрузить компьютер.


PS:

Как правило, необходимость сброса настроек протокола TCP/IP связана с некорректным поведением системы после повреждения вирусами. Поэтому, неплохо бы предварительно запускать свежее средство удаления вредоносных программ для ОС Microsoft® Windows® (KB890830). В частности, мне это средство помогло с исправлением следующей проблемы:
  • Компьютер не пинговался, однако с этого компьютера локальные сетевые ресурсы были доступны
  • Несмотря на то, что тип запуска службы Автоматического обновления Windows был "Авто", эта служба после каждой перезагрузки компьютера не стартовала, а тип ее запуска сбрасывался в "Отключено"
  • Браузеры не открывали многие страницы, в частности, находящиеся по адресу microsoft.com.
После прогона свежего средства удаления вредоносных программ для ОС Microsoft® Windows® (KB890830) в ПОЛНОМ режиме все вышеперечисленные проблемы исчезли.